I got all my old video game consoles and games out of storage a couple months ago and have been down a retro video game rabbit hole. Cleaned them all up and started playing some. NES, SNES, N64, Gamecube( my favorite), PS1, PS2, PS3, Xbox, Xbox 360. Saw some setups and end goal is to have an area where I can display them all and have them all hooked to the same TV. I want to get the rest of the old consoles I don’t have as well. I was amazed at what some of those old games are worth nowadays. I have a PriceCharting App that tells you what the games are actually worth nowadays. Needless to say I got a new hobby or hunting old retro games at Flea Markets, garage sales and other retro game places. I don’t have any too crazy expensive but do have a few NES games I could sell on eBay for over 100 bucks . If you have your old stuff put in storage and you have certain games you could be sitting on some old games that are worth a lot. Most expensive NES game is worth 16,100 loose and it’s called Stadium Events if you had the box and manual it’s in the 32,000 range another one Little Samson is worth 2,200 range just the cartridge and way more with the box and manual. If only you could find one at a garage sale. lol. I’m glad I held on to my old stuff and didn’t trade it in back in the day for new consoles. It’s been a fun hobby to get back into.
